linux常用命令-文件处理
-
ls
功能:显示目录文件
ls 选项 [-ald] [文件或目录]
-a 显示所有文件,包括隐藏文件
-l 详细信息显示
-d 查看目录属性 -
cd
功能: 切换目录
cd [目录]
cd / (切换到根目录)
cd . . (切换到上一级目录) -
pwd
功能:显示当前工作目录 -
touch
功能:创建空文件
touch [文件名]
例: touch helloword.cpp -
mkdir
功能: 创建新目录
例:mkdir helloword -
cp
功能: 复制文件或目录
cp -R [源文件或目录] [目标目录]
-R 复制目录 -
mv
功能:移动文件或更名
文件 -> 文件 (更名)
文件 -> 目录 (移动)
mv [源文件或目录] [目的目录] -
rm
功能: 删除文件
rm -r [文件或目录]
-r 删除目录 -
cat
功能: 显示文件内容
cat [文件名] (一般用不上) -
more
功能: 分页显示文件内容
more [文件名]
(空格) 或 f 显示下一页
(enter) 显示下一行
Q 或 q 退出 -
head
功能 : 查看文件的前几行
head -num [文件名]
-num 显示文件的前 num 行 -
tail
功能 : 查看文件的后几行
tail -num [文件名]
-num 显示文件的后 num 行 -
ln
功能 : 产生链接文件
ln -s [源文件] [目标文件]
-s 创建软链接